Pawan Shankar puts acting career on hold

Mumbai:  Actor Pawan Shankar, who has appeared in TV shows like "Siddhanth", "Vicky Ki Taxi" and "Kya Hua Tera Vaada", says for now he is putting his acting career on hold and focussing on being an educationist. The actor turned into an entrepreneur with his company Educationista. His company got the Indian Award For Excellence 2016 for being the fastest growing company in the education sector. "Acting is my passion and I will never be further from it. In fact, I feel sad when I turn down offers as I am busy with Educationista's Prestigious School Fairs till January. Post that you will see me on television again," Pawan told IANS. Currently, the actor is busy with Prestigious Schools Exhibition -- a platform for school children which organises school fairs in Maharashtra, Tamil Nadu, Kerala, Madhya Pradesh, Uttar Pradesh and Chhattisgarh among others. His next exhibition will be held in Thane, followed by Worli and Goregaon in Mumbai and then Coimbatore, Kanpur, Pune, Raipur and Nagpur. The actor said: "In today's time, thanks to the exposure to gadgets and technology, children begin to show their aptitudes early on and I am looking at an environment conducive to hone their skills." Shankar, an MBA in finance from the Institute of Management Technology (IMT), Ghaziabad and former national champion in table tennis India, has also starred in over 50 advertisements.
